Prize Money breakdown for the 2020 UK Open Darts with £450,000 on offer

The Prize Money Breakdown has been released for the 2020 UK Open which begins on Friday at Butlins in Minehead.

The prize money breakdown will stay the same for the UK Open comprising of £450,000. The winner of the title will claim £100,000 with the runner-up getting just under half of that at £40,000. £20,000 will go to the semi-finalists and £12,500 to the Quarter-Finalists.

From there the Prize Fund Breakdown goes down in small implements to the third round with £1,000 for reaching that point. The players who start in the first and second round, need to win one or two matches to be eligible for some cash prizes.

The prize money UK Open 2020:

Stage (no. of players) Prize Money
(Total: £450,000)
Winner (1) £100,000
Runner-up (1) £40,000
Semi-finalists (2) £20,000
Quarter-finalists (4) £12,500
Last 16 (Sixth round) (8) £7,500
Last 32 (Fifth round) (16) £4,000
Last 64 (Fourth round) (32) £2,000
Last 96 (Third round) (32) £1,000
Last 128 (Second round) (32) n/a
Last 160 (First round) (32) n/a
